Using This Workbook in a Group

Group Sessions • Waiting to Exhale Parties • Girls Night Meetings

Host: You don’t need to teach, fix, or perform. Your role is to hold space, not hold answers.

  • Create a relaxed environment. Good food and a calming atmosphere are all you need.

  • Participants purchase their own workbooks on Amazon or downloadable printables on Etsy.

  • Select a workbook section in advance.

  • Be intentional about who you invite.

  • Establish Ground Rules.

  • Respect all voices.

  • Do not interrupt others with your story or comment.

  • Think before speaking.. Ask is it encouraging.

  • Inform participants that confidentiality is not guaranteed.

  • No judgment.

  • Close by inviting each woman to name one takeaway and one action.

  • Remind the group that clarity comes before goals.
